Chro58 Talbot-Lago T26 Record Cabriolet Saoutchik 1948 sn100272

Sold new to Salah Orabi and Princess Nevine Abbas Halim of Egypt, 100272 Talbot Lago T26 Record belongs to the collection of Jacques Baillon since 1952.

This particularly rare car that was believed lost was sold at a record price at the Artcurial Retromobile 2015 sale.

She is one of 208 copies T26 Record built in 1948 and is one of the rare cases where a chassis was ever sent to a famous bodybuilder to receive exclusive bodywork.

Saoutchik realized a masterpiece: the pointed hood and grille shaped shark nose, a rounded front fender with integrated headlights and anti fog lights, rear wings graceful fully bodied, and finally the long and sloping rear.

100272 was the subject of considerable promotion at the time, as in the Paris Salon of October 1948 where many French newspapers contained pictures of this amazing car.

An exceptional cabriolet spectacular lines, elegant automatic opening doors button, fully retractable roof that was signed by Saoutchik, massive chrome patterns and its wide grille, form a stunning whole.
